"Sampporn Aarti Sangrah" book compiles an extensive collection of Aarti prayers, fundamental to Hindu worship ceremonies. Aarti, pronounced 'aarti,' is a significant ritual involving the offering of light to deities, symbolizing the divine presence and the dispelling of darkness. This ritual, performed with immense gratitude and love, is an integral part of Hindu worship, undertaken after prayers or auspicious ceremonies. The practice of Aarti has its roots in the ancient Vedic period, embodying the removal of sorrows and the expression of complete love towards God.
